Why Chasing Trends Doesn’t Pay Off

Many companies fall into the trap of implementing tools without a clear use case or integration plan. The result is a tech stack that’s bloated, siloed, and underutilized. These decisions can slow down operations, confuse users, and dilute your strategic focus.

 

This pattern is so common it has a name: “shiny object syndrome.” It’s the urge to adopt new technologies based on hype rather than fit. And it’s a distraction that costs time, money, and momentum.

 


How to Prioritize What Actually Moves the Needle

The smartest organizations don’t invest based on popularity—they invest based on alignment. That means asking tough but essential questions:

 

  • What are our current business objectives?

  • Where are we seeing friction or inefficiency?

  • Will this solution integrate with our existing architecture?

  • Do we have the internal readiness to adopt it?

  • Will this scale with us as we grow?

 

It’s not about saying no to innovation—it’s about saying yes to the right innovations.
